Fast growing, feathery summer flower with sky blue blossoms and finely divided leaves. Outdoor cultivation is straight forward and it is avoided by slugs. After flowering it develops pretty seed capsules. Suitable as a dried flower for professional flower growers.
Characteristics
Botanical name: Nigella damascenaUse: Cut flower, Drying, Good for insects and beesFlower colour: sky-blueHeight in cm: 40-50Vegetation period: annual
Cultivation
Planting distance (cm): 15 x 20Seed required for 1000 plants (g): 5Sowing depth: ca. 1 cm
